It should be pretty easy.

1) Open up your "AdvancedReport.vbs" file with Windows Notepad, then copy the ini entry from the comment at the top. If you are unsure what that looks like, look at the two links I provided. You could even just copy the ini entry from one of these two links instead. That would save you the step of removing the apostrophes.
viewtopic.php?f=2&t=7855&start=555#p283516
or
viewtopic.php?f=2&t=7855&start=450#p256679

2)Paste that into your "Scripts.ini" file. As I mentioned, If you are using MediaMonkey 4., your "Scripts.ini" file will be located in the "C:\Users\XXX\AppData\Roaming\MediaMonkey\Scripts" folder. If using MediaMonkey 3, your "Scripts.ini" file will be located at "C:\Program Files (x86)\MediaMonkey\Scripts".

3) When copying to the "Scripts.ini" file, just follow the same progression. That is, make another entry at the end of all the other entries.

Hopefully that helps.
